Output 66d43691eafbdd70ff07e16020661b6d53d903acf787aa2f43c637579357891d:14

value
306031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28adb7e9710d621e04b40093b69af47f011d3d25 OP_EQUAL
address
35Q74PC3KuVKFQ1PnWQV7HL2NVucFtTg1s
transaction
66d43691eafbdd70ff07e16020661b6d53d903acf787aa2f43c637579357891d
spent
true